About Douglas Rushkoff
Douglas Rushkoff was American writer and media theorist. Douglas Mark Rushkoff is an American media theorist, writer, professor, columnist, lecturer, graphic novelist, documentarian and podcaster. He is best known for his association with the early cyberpunk culture, his advocacy of open source solutions to social problems, his critique of technocapitalism, and his call to retrieve our humanity in a digital age.
